Classics That Never Get Old
Some sitcoms are timeless. Friends remains the gold standard for ensemble comedy, with its iconic coffee shop hangouts and unforgettable catchphrases. But don't stop there—Parks and Recreation offers a similarly warm, hilarious look at local government, led by Amy Poehler's legendary performance. Other classics like The Fresh Prince of Bel-Air and Seinfeld defined the genre, proving that smart writing and strong chemistry never go out of style. If you've somehow missed these, now's the perfect time to binge.
Modern Hits You Can't Miss
The sitcom landscape has evolved, with shows like Abbott Elementary and St. Denis Medical bringing fresh perspectives to the workplace comedy. These series tackle real-world issues with sharp humor and diverse casts, making them essential viewing for today's audience. Other modern gems include The Good Place, which reimagines the afterlife with philosophical wit, and Brooklyn Nine-Nine, a cop comedy that balances slapstick with heart. These shows prove that the sitcom format is alive and well.
Underrated Gems Worth Your Time
Not every great sitcom gets the attention it deserves. Happy Endings and Community are cult favorites that reward dedicated viewers with rapid-fire jokes and meta-humor. Similarly, Schitt's Creek started slow but became a phenomenon thanks to its heartfelt character arcs.
